Medical Imaging Interaction Toolkit  2016.11.0
Medical Imaging Interaction Toolkit
mitk::DataStorage Member List

This is the complete list of members for mitk::DataStorage, including all inherited members.

Add(mitk::DataNode *node, const mitk::DataStorage::SetOfObjects *parents=nullptr)=0mitk::DataStoragepure virtual
Add(mitk::DataNode *node, mitk::DataNode *parent)mitk::DataStorage
AddListeners(const mitk::DataNode *_Node)mitk::DataStorageprotected
AddNodeEventmitk::DataStorage
BlockNodeModifiedEvents(bool block)mitk::DataStorage
ChangedNodeEventmitk::DataStorage
ComputeBoundingBox(const char *boolPropertyKey=nullptr, const mitk::BaseRenderer *renderer=nullptr, const char *boolPropertyKey2=nullptr)mitk::DataStorage
ComputeBoundingGeometry3D(const SetOfObjects *input, const char *boolPropertyKey=nullptr, const mitk::BaseRenderer *renderer=nullptr, const char *boolPropertyKey2=nullptr) const mitk::DataStorage
ComputeBoundingGeometry3D(const char *boolPropertyKey=nullptr, const mitk::BaseRenderer *renderer=nullptr, const char *boolPropertyKey2=nullptr) const mitk::DataStorage
ComputeTimeBounds(const char *boolPropertyKey, const mitk::BaseRenderer *renderer, const char *boolPropertyKey2)mitk::DataStorage
ComputeTimeBounds(const mitk::BaseRenderer *renderer, const char *boolPropertyKey)mitk::DataStorageinline
ComputeVisibleBoundingBox(const mitk::BaseRenderer *renderer=nullptr, const char *boolPropertyKey=nullptr)mitk::DataStorageinline
ComputeVisibleBoundingGeometry3D(const mitk::BaseRenderer *renderer=nullptr, const char *boolPropertyKey=nullptr)mitk::DataStorage
ConstPointer typedefmitk::DataStorage
DataStorage()mitk::DataStorageprotected
DataStorageEvent typedefmitk::DataStorage
DeleteNodeEventmitk::DataStorage
EmitAddNodeEvent(const mitk::DataNode *node)mitk::DataStorageprotected
EmitRemoveNodeEvent(const mitk::DataNode *node)mitk::DataStorageprotected
Exists(const mitk::DataNode *node) const =0mitk::DataStoragepure virtual
FilterSetOfObjects(const SetOfObjects *set, const NodePredicateBase *condition) const mitk::DataStorageprotected
GetAll() const =0mitk::DataStoragepure virtual
GetClassHierarchy() const mitk::DataStorageinlinevirtual
GetClassName() const mitk::DataStoragevirtual
GetDerivations(const mitk::DataNode *node, const NodePredicateBase *condition=nullptr, bool onlyDirectDerivations=true) const =0mitk::DataStoragepure virtual
GetGroupTags() const mitk::DataStorage
GetNamedDerivedNode(const char *name, const mitk::DataNode *sourceNode, bool onlyDirectDerivations=true) const mitk::DataStorage
GetNamedDerivedObject(const char *name, const mitk::DataNode *sourceNode, bool onlyDirectDerivations=true) const mitk::DataStorageinline
GetNamedNode(const char *name) const mitk::DataStorage
GetNamedNode(const std::string name) const mitk::DataStorageinline
GetNamedObject(const char *name) const mitk::DataStorageinline
GetNamedObject(const std::string name) const mitk::DataStorageinline
GetNode(const NodePredicateBase *condition=nullptr) const mitk::DataStorage
GetSources(const mitk::DataNode *node, const NodePredicateBase *condition=nullptr, bool onlyDirectSources=true) const =0mitk::DataStoragepure virtual
GetStaticNameOfClass()mitk::DataStorageinlinestatic
GetSubset(const NodePredicateBase *condition) const mitk::DataStorage
InteractorChangedNodeEventmitk::DataStorage
m_BlockNodeModifiedEventsmitk::DataStorageprotected
m_MutexOnemitk::DataStoragemutable
m_NodeDeleteObserverTagsmitk::DataStorageprotected
m_NodeInteractorChangedObserverTagsmitk::DataStorageprotected
m_NodeModifiedObserverTagsmitk::DataStorageprotected
OnNodeInteractorChanged(itk::Object *caller, const itk::EventObject &event)mitk::DataStorageprotected
OnNodeModifiedOrDeleted(const itk::Object *caller, const itk::EventObject &event)mitk::DataStorageprotected
Pointer typedefmitk::DataStorage
PrintSelf(std::ostream &os, itk::Indent indent) const overridemitk::DataStorageprotectedvirtual
Remove(const mitk::DataNode *node)=0mitk::DataStoragepure virtual
Remove(const mitk::DataStorage::SetOfObjects *nodes)mitk::DataStorage
RemoveListeners(const mitk::DataNode *_Node)mitk::DataStorageprotected
RemoveNodeEventmitk::DataStorage
Self typedefmitk::DataStorage
SetOfObjects typedefmitk::DataStorage
Superclass typedefmitk::DataStorage
~DataStorage()mitk::DataStorageprotectedvirtual